Giovanni Battista Antici (17 July, 1631 – 17 July, 1690) was a Roman Catholic prelate who served as Bishop of Amelia (1685–1690).
Biography
Giovanni Battista Antici was born in Recanati, Italy on 17 Jul 1631 and ordained a priest on 6 Apr 1658. On 9 Apr 1685, he was appointed during the papacy of Pope Innocent XI as Bishop of Amelia. On 23 Apr 1685, he was consecrated bishop by Alessandro Crescenzi (cardinal), Cardinal-Priest of Santa Prisca, with Diego Petra, Archbishop of Sorrento, and Pier Antonio Capobianco, Bishop Emeritus of Lacedonia, serving as co-consecrators. He served as Bishop of Amelia until his death on 17 Jul 1690.
